This Sevierville-based tasting tour packs four stops into one smooth, hosted experience — We start with a guided spirits tasting at Junction 35, then sit down for an included lunch right there (each guest selects an entrée from the Smoky Tours lunch menu). After lunch, we continue the fun with a wine & cider tasting at Tennessee Homemade, and finish strong with moonshine tastings at Smith Creek.
This is a hosted, walkable/close-proximity experience designed for great pacing, lots of tastings, and zero planning stress — no designated driver needed. Valid photo ID required for all tastings.

Junction 35 Spirits Tasting (Sevierville/Tanger)
Kick off the tour with a hosted, VIP-style spirits tasting at Junction 35. You’ll sample a variety of their popular moonshines, vodkas, bourbon and whiskeys while learning a bit about the flavors, process, and local spirit culture. Great first stop to set the tone and get the group having fun right away. Valid photo ID required for tastings.
Enjoy a sit-down lunch at Junction 35 Spirits, included with your tour. Each guest chooses one entrée from the Smoky Tours lunch menu—guest favorites often include the Pulled Pork Sandwich (with Honey Bourbon BBQ), Chicken Club (fried or grilled), Classic Burger, Smoked Wings, or a House Salad. Dietary options are available (including gluten-free bun upon request and vegetarian-friendly swaps). Menu items may vary slightly.
Next, enjoy a tasting at Tennessee Homemade, where you’ll sample a variety of local wines and ciders. This stop is a great balance after spirits—easygoing, flavorful, and perfect for finding a bottle (or two) to take home.
Finish strong at Smith Creek Moonshine with another round of moonshine tastings featuring bold, fun flavors. It’s a great final stop for comparing favorites, grabbing souvenirs, and ending the tour on a high note.

Sevierville, Tennessee, is a charming city nestled at the entrance to the Great Smoky Mountains National Park. Known as 'The Gateway to the Smokies,' it offers a blend of natural beauty, outdoor adventures, and Southern hospitality. The city is also famous as the hometown of Dolly Parton, featuring attractions like Dollywood and the Dolly Parton's Chasing Rainbows Museum.
